Hey all. I'm wondering if anyone can recognize this book for me, I read it in the early-mid nineties, and it involved a post nuclear war Earth. There were a couple of different versions of humanity in it. One group was survivors of the war who'd adapted to life on the surface and their society had become sort of nomadic tribe who used Afghanhound--like dogs as part of their warfare. The other group was some cryogenically frozen people from just before the war who'd just woke up and were confused about what was going on. There was also a plot point about one of the latter using the tactics from the Battle of Cowpens to win a battle in the post apocalyptic era.

Does anyone know which book this might be? The cover definitely had artwork of an Afghanhound on it.

Could it be Warrior by Donald E. McQuinn? It was first published in 1990 and is first part of a trilogy, The Moondark Saga, and Wanderer and Witch are the other parts.

Summary from Amazon:
In the grand landscape of the Pacific Northwest, two great kingdoms battle to rule the inlet sea. Gan Moondark is expected to one day rule the Dog People, but war and prophesy have a different fate in store for him.

The balance of power in the region is about to shift when a centuries old cryogenic crèche awakens. It brings to life military leaders from a long forgotten war, with weapons and technology unlike anything this world has ever seen.

Will these strangers help Gan Moondark start a new era of peace and prosperity? Or will they drive the three kingdoms further into brutality and war?
